Summary

The Intern will support ongoing biomedical engineering research focused on organ perfusion systems and related experimental models. This role offers hands-on training in laboratory techniques, engineering design, and data analysis, including working with biological tissues and perfusate systems. The intern will assist in experiment setup, prototype development, and evaluation of system performance, while contributing to research activities that integrate biomaterials, fluid dynamics, and device design. This position provides exposure to both in vitro and ex vivo systems, fostering skill development in data interpretation, technical documentation, and iterative problem-solving in a collaborative research environment.
